ACTING NANNY....

During Lebaran Holiday I was trapped in a sweet circle called “best friends’ family holiday”. I spent two nights with Felix’s and Rasdi’s family in Felix’s house. And they spent two nights in my house. To me the idea was I didn’t want to spend the holiday alone. And to them the idea was they had to have a new atmosphere for their children. What a mutual benefit!

Since I was the only one ‘new’ for the kids, they glued to me most of the time. With four kids (Mila, Adi, Jovi, and the sweetest Amadea) on the ground I started acting nanny hahaha…. It’s even more interesting when my brother’s family, Yudhi, joined the circle. Caitlyn, my niece, added my happiness.

I learned a lot through their daily life as parents. Three families with three different parenting styles. Some to be noted down, some to be ignored. Yet, they have something in common to share. Love.

I admire Felix and Christin’s way of raising their kids. They give trust to Jovi, six years old, and Amadea, four years old. Trust that they can survive alone. Can you imagine, they left them alone in a swimming pool; simply because they have strong believe that their kids will take care of each other. Good things to learn for Rasdi and Erna so they gave an opportunity for Mila, six years old, and her five years old brother, Adi, to be as independent as Jovi and Amadea. When I shared this story to my brother, he said… I might not have the gut to leave Caitlyn alone at swimming pool at Amadea’s age. Well… different people different opinion. If I said the same thing to Tina, my sister in law, she might have another different expression.

The holiday ended with a picnic to Taman Buah Mekar Sari, Cileungsi. The weather was very dry and hot. We left the place at about 2 p.m. to take our late lunch at Cibubur area. Then back to my house again to enjoy es buah pinggir jalan.

On top of our happiness, I got a small note prepared by Mila and Jovi signed by all family members, saying how happy they were to spend the holiday together with me. Me too kids… I was very happy to have you and your parents together. I might be the most expensive nanny you ever had hahaha…. Thanks to your parents to give me the opportunity!
